Blame-farming

What is Blame-farming?


1.

The task of assigning responsibility for resolving a problem which the assigner doesn't understand and has no idea how to resolve, with the intention of blaming an unsuspecting assignee or "blame hound" when the problem isn't resolved. Commonly found in corporate environments and governments.

That new manager is a real blame-farmer.

He must have majored in Blame-Farming!
